Tuesday, March 24th 7:00 pm REI Salt Lake City
Carol Masheter, a local mountaineer, summitted this iconic mountain for the second time on Christmas Eve Day, 2007. Climbing Kilimanjaro is like passing through all four seasons in six days. Near the start of the climb, colobus monkeys swing through the verdant rain forest. Higher on the mountain, iridescent bee eaters dart among giant lobelia and giant groundsel after the mid morning sun has melted the previous evening's snow. The summit is ice and snow with a fantastic view of the plains below, teeming with wildlife. Carol has been climbing big, glaciated peaks since 1972, including Everest in Spring, 2008, Kilimanjaro in December, 2007, Aconcagua in January, 2007, Cho Oyu in 2005 and over a dozen glaciated peaks in Bolivia, Ecuador and East Africa.
